The Importance Of Industrial Incinerators In Waste Management

industrial incinerators play a crucial role in the proper management of waste materials, especially in industries that generate large amounts of waste on a daily basis. These incinerators are designed to safely and efficiently burn various types of waste, including hazardous and non-hazardous materials, reducing the volume of waste and minimizing its environmental impact. In this article, we will discuss the importance of industrial incinerators in waste management and how they contribute to a cleaner and safer environment.

One of the key benefits of industrial incinerators is their ability to reduce the volume of waste generated by industries. By burning waste materials at high temperatures, incinerators can significantly reduce the volume of waste, making it easier to handle, transport, and dispose of. This is particularly important for industries that generate large amounts of waste on a regular basis, such as manufacturing plants, chemical plants, and hospitals.

In addition to reducing waste volume, industrial incinerators also help to minimize the environmental impact of waste disposal. When waste materials are burned in an incinerator, they are converted into ash, gases, and heat. The ash can be safely disposed of in a landfill, while the gases can be treated and released into the atmosphere in a controlled manner. This process helps to prevent the release of harmful pollutants into the environment, protecting air and water quality and reducing the risk of environmental contamination.

Furthermore, industrial incinerators are an effective solution for the disposal of hazardous waste materials. Many industries produce hazardous waste as a byproduct of their operations, including chemicals, solvents, and heavy metals. These materials can pose serious health and environmental risks if not handled properly. industrial incinerators are specifically designed to safely burn hazardous waste materials at high temperatures, destroying harmful contaminants and reducing the risk of exposure to humans and the environment.

Another important benefit of industrial incinerators is their ability to generate energy from waste materials. Some incinerators are equipped with energy recovery systems that capture and utilize the heat produced during the combustion process to generate electricity or heat. This not only helps to reduce the consumption of fossil fuels but also provides a sustainable source of energy for industrial operations. By converting waste into energy, industrial incinerators contribute to the reduction of greenhouse gas emissions and help to combat climate change.

In addition to their environmental benefits, industrial incinerators also offer economic advantages for industries. By reducing waste volume and minimizing disposal costs, incinerators can help businesses save money on waste management expenses. Furthermore, the energy generated from waste materials can be used to offset energy costs, providing additional cost savings for industrial operations. Overall, industrial incinerators offer a cost-effective and efficient solution for managing waste materials in a responsible and sustainable manner.

Despite their many benefits, industrial incinerators have faced criticism from environmental groups and communities concerned about air pollution and public health risks. It is important for industries to implement strict emissions controls and monitor air quality to ensure that incinerators operate in compliance with environmental regulations. Modern incinerators are equipped with advanced pollution control technologies, such as scrubbers, filters, and monitoring systems, to reduce emissions of harmful pollutants and protect the environment and public health.
